LONDON – Arnold Allen blitzed Yaotzin Meza with a series of hard left hands just as the horn sounded to end the fight, leaving one fighter on the floor and his opponent celebrating as if he’d just won by knockout. However, Allen (11-1 MMA, 2-0 UFC) had to settle for a victory by unanimous decision since his attack on Meza (21-11 MMA, 2-4 UFC) came just a hair too late, though all three judges still gave the fight to Allen by scores of 30-27 across the board. The featherweight bout was part of today’s UFC Fight Night 84 preliminary card at The O2 in London. It streamed on UFC Fight Pass. The furious burst to end the fight was a stark contrast to much of the action the preceded it as Allen fought a patient, competent fight against a somewhat listless Meza for the bulk of the three-round affair
